The nonfiction market is full of opportunity, but to succeed in selling your book, you need to master the art of writing a nonfiction proposal. Competition is fierce and publishers are becoming more and more demanding. You need to not just be able to explain your concept clearly and engagingly, but prove the demand for the book and why you’re the best writer for the job.

In Write to Sell: Nonfiction Proposals, Gina Panettieri will guide you through the process of crafting a compelling nonfiction book proposal. This live webinar will cover essential topics such as identifying and analyzing the target audience, understanding market trends, and writing a persuasive and well-structured proposal. Participants will also learn how to present themselves as the perfect writer for their book and compose the perfect pitch to grab an editor’s or agent’s attention.

Gina Panettieri is the Founder and President of Talcott Notch Literary Services, a five-member literary agency headquartered in Connecticut. She has worked in the publishing industry for 35 years as an agent, editor and author. She’s worked with dozens of nonfiction authors, writing a range of nonfiction from business and career to health, cookbooks, true crime, history, medicine, parenting, law, memoir and more. .
